Torah, Neviim and Ketuvim – Venice, 1552-1563 – Printed by Giustiniani – Torah Section Scarce, Not in NLI

Torah, Neviim and Ketuvim – Bible edition comprised of sections of the Bible printed in Venice by Marco Antonio Giustiniani at various times:
Five Books of the Torah. Venice, 1563. Bound with: Neviim Rishonim and Acharonim, and Ketuvim. Venice, [1552].
No Hebrew books were printed in Venice from the burning of the Talmud in 1553, until 1562. Presumably, the Torah section was bound with the Neviim and Ketuvim sections by the printer, putting to use copies remaining from a Bible edition printed before the burning of the Talmud.
All parts in one volume. Torah: 141 leaves, [1] blank leaf. Neviim Rishonim: [1], 146-254 leaves. Neviim Acharonim: 255-369 leaves, [1] blank leaf. Ketuvim: 124 leaves. Approx. 20 cm. Light-colored, high-quality paper. Good condition. Stains. Minor open tear to final leaf, slightly affecting text, and minor marginal tears to final two leaves, not affecting text. Wormhole to first leaves, slightly affecting text. Minor marginal worming to one of final leaves. Original leather binding, with late paper and tape repairs. Damage to binding.
The Torah section is recorded in the Bibliography of the Hebrew Book according to the copy in Biblioteca Palatina, Parma, and does not appear in the NLI catalog.
